Paris Ultras threaten Vlahovic: “If you come, we’ll cut off all three fingers”
Vlahovic is close to Paris Saint-Germain, but part of the club’s organized supporters have not forgotten a three-fingered gesture symbolizing Serbian nationalism and openly threatened him.
Dusan Vlahovic is close to leaving Juventus, since, according to Footmercato, he has reached an agreement with Paris.
The contract has a term of five years and his annual earnings amount to 11 million euros plus the bonuses he receives for the number of goals and games played, a little over 9 million euros.
The ‘Bianconeri’ are convinced to sell him and now the two teams will start negotiations to find the amount to close the deal.
However, the organized Parisians are not particularly happy with this prospect and have openly threatened him. The reason is a gesture from him with three fingers raised.
It is a Serbian greeting that expressed the Holy Trinity and is mainly used today as a nod, symbolizing Serbian nationalism. He made this move while playing against Serbia wearing a jersey that featured Kosovo as part of Serbia.
A group of Paris fans took a photo in front of the Prinzenpark and sent a threatening message to Vlahovic: “If you come, we’ll cut off all three of your fingers.”
